I. be [bi:] V. intr. was, been
1. be + sust./adj. permanent state, quality, identity:
be
ser
she's a cook
es cocinera
she's Spanish
es española
to be good
ser bueno
to be able to do sth
ser capaz de hacer algo
what do you want to be when you grow up?
¿qué quieres ser de mayor?
to be married/single
estar [o ser Co. Sur] casado/soltero
to be a widow
ser viuda
2. be + adj. mental and physical states:
be
estar
to be fat
estar gordo
to be hungry
tener hambre
to be happy
estar contento
3. be (age):
be
tener
I'm 21
tengo 21 años
4. be indicates sb's opinion:
to be for/against sth
estar a favor/en contra de algo
5. be calculation, cost:
two and two is four
dos y dos son cuatro
these glasses are £2 each
estos vasos cuestan 2 libras cada uno
how much is that?
¿cuánto es?
6. be (measurement):
be
medir
be weight
pesar
to be 2 metres long
medir 2 metros de largo
7. be (exist, live):
there is/are ...
hay...
to let sth/sb be
dejar en paz algo/a alguien
I think, therefore I am
pienso, luego existo
to be or not to be
ser o no ser
8. be location, situation:
be
estar
to be in Rome
estar en Roma
to be in a bad situation
estar en una mala situación
9. be part. pas. (go, visit):
I've never been to Mexico
nunca he estado en Méjico
the plumber hasn't been yet
el fontanero todavía no ha venido
10. be (take place):
be
ser
be
tener lugar
the meeting is next Tuesday
la reunión es el próximo martes
11. be circumstances:
to be on the pill
tomar la píldora
to be on vacation
estar de vacaciones
to be on a diet
estar a régimen
12. be in time expressions:
don't be too long
no tardes mucho
13. be expresses possibility:
can it be that ...? form.
¿puede ser que... +subj ?
what are we to do?
¿qué podemos hacer?
locuciones, giros idiomáticos:
be that as it may
sea como fuere
so be it
así sea
II. be [bi:] V. impers vb
be expressing physical conditions, circumstances:
it's cloudy
está nublado
it's sunny
hace sol
it's two o'clock
son las dos
it's been so long!
¡cuánto tiempo!
it's ten minutes by bus to the market
el mercado está a diez minutos en autobús
it was Anne who drank it
fue Anne quien se lo bebió
III. be [bi:] V. aux. vb
1. be expresses continuation:
be
estar
to be doing sth
estar haciendo algo
don't sing while I'm reading
no cantes mientras estoy leyendo [o mientras leo]
you're always complaining
siempre te estás quejando
she's leaving tomorrow
se va mañana
2. be expresses passive:
be
ser
to be discovered by sb
ser descubierto por alguien
he was left speechless
lo dejaron sin palabras
he was asked ...
le preguntaron...
3. be expresses future:
we are to visit Peru in the winter
vamos a ir a Perú en invierno
4. be expresses future in past:
she was never to see her brother again
nunca más volvería a ver a su hermano
5. be expresses subjunctive possibility in conditionals:
if he was to work harder, he'd get better grades
si trabajara más, sacaría mejores notas
were I to refuse, they'd be very annoyed
si me negara, se enfadarían mucho
6. be expresses obligation:
you are to come here right now
tienes que venir aquí ahora mismo
7. be in question tags:
she is tall, isn't she?
es alta, ¿no?
